Located 15 miles southwest of Houston in Fort Bend County, Richmond’s history dates back to 1822, when a group of twelve men set up camp near the present-day city and were followed by Stephen F. Austin’s famed Old Three Hundred colonists.
Originally known as “Fort Bend” or “Fort Settlement,” it became one of the first 19 cities incorporated by the Republic of Texas. Today, you’ll still find beautifully preserved historic homes, along with many things to explore and some fun watering holes, to boot.
The Best Bars in Richmond
- Braman Winery and Brewery – Braman Winery and Running Walker Beer join forces to make the first winery and brewery under one roof in the Lone Star State. Hit the Tap & Tasting Room to enjoy wines and suds, live music and trivia nights, and rotating food trucks. Click here for directions.
- Clancy’s Public House – This friendly Irish pub rocks 30 taps and a 50-count bottle list of beers and ciders, plus adult beverages like the Irish Mule and build-your-own Irish Coffee, and eats from beef Reubens to shepherd’s pie. - Lone Star Saloon – Housed in a building that has been a neighborhood stalwart for over 120 years, this saloon is one of the best places around to pop a cold one and get a taste of the country-western life. Its stage draws a lineup of musicians from around the state that gets the crowd going with live country jams. Cover ranges from free to $10. Click here for directions.
